TARIFF OF DUTIES IN SPANISH WNEST INDIES. The history of the Spanish colonies, either continental or island, presents the same pictures of wrong and oppression. They have been regarded, in every period of their existence, by the home government, as entitled to no other rights or privileges than such as might be tolerated by an avaricious despotism. The colonial code asserted the most monstrous principles, whose execution was a warfare against humianity itself Rapacity and extortion were familiar to the rulers, and to indulge them to the best purpose and with impunity, the darling object of every measure. The crimes which have thus been committed shock us by their atrocity, and paved the way for those South Amlerican and Mexican revolutions, which resulted so happily in independence. With all her greediness of wealth, however, what has been the progress of Spain, and how miserable and abject is her condition withal! To give some idea of this colonial system, we would remark, that the whole property was considered as vested in the crown of Spain. It was a capital offense to carry on trade with foreigners, and even the different colonies were forbidden any intercourse. They were not permitted to cultivate certain articles, and the crown reserved the monopoly of others. No other than a native of Spain could fill an office of trust or honor, under the state. Intolerance and bigotry in religion were maintained, and knowledge itself proscribed as dangerous. The West India Islands, from their extraordinary fertility, experi enced less of the ills of these restrictions, at all times;,but latterly, the increase of smuggling operations and the impossibility of the colo nists being supplied by the mother country with articles of consump tion, as well as the progress of more liberal principles, have induced many important modifications in the commercial system of the islands.
